A TubeBuddy Alternative for Small Creators (Free, No Extension Bloat)
TubeBuddy earned its place — bulk tools, A/B thumbnail tests, a tag manager. But most of that matters at scale. If you’re under 10k subscribers, the honest truth is you don’t have a tagging problem. You have a what-do-I-film problem.
Different problem, lighter tool.
What a small creator actually needs
- A go/no-go on a topic before spending a weekend on it.
- A read on whether the niche still has room.
- A title that earns the click.
- A realistic sense of what the channel could earn.
None of that requires a subscription or a browser extension watching every tab.

When TubeBuddy still wins
If you publish daily, manage a back catalog of hundreds of videos, or run bulk SEO across a large channel, a full suite pays for itself. We’re not pretending otherwise.
But if you’re a recipe or faceless creator deciding what to shoot this week, you don’t need the cockpit. You need the answer.
